Ripple Adoption Grows in Asia and Middle East — Is XRP Undervalued?

Ripple is quietly expanding its footprint — and not just in Western markets.

Across Asia and the Middle East, Ripple’s cross-border payment technology is gaining traction. Financial institutions, fintech firms, and payment providers are increasingly exploring blockchain-based settlement solutions.

As adoption grows, investors are asking an important question:

Is XRP undervalued relative to its expanding global presence?

Let’s break down what’s happening and what it could mean for XRP’s long-term outlook.

Ripple’s Strategic Focus on Asia

Asia has long been a key growth market for Ripple.

The region is home to:

  • High remittance corridors
  • Rapid fintech innovation
  • Pro-crypto regulatory environments in certain jurisdictions
  • Growing institutional interest in blockchain payments

Countries across Southeast Asia and East Asia continue to explore blockchain infrastructure to reduce settlement costs and improve transaction speed.

Ripple’s payment solutions aim to provide:

  • Faster cross-border settlements
  • Reduced transaction fees
  • Improved liquidity management
  • Transparent transaction tracking

As demand for efficient remittance systems rises, XRP’s underlying blockchain infrastructure becomes increasingly relevant.

Middle East: A Growing Blockchain Hub

The Middle East has emerged as one of the most crypto-forward regions globally.

Several countries are actively positioning themselves as digital asset hubs by:

  • Introducing crypto-friendly regulatory frameworks
  • Licensing digital asset service providers
  • Encouraging fintech innovation

Ripple’s presence in the region reflects this shift.

Cross-border payment demand is strong in the Middle East due to international trade flows and remittance markets. Blockchain-based settlement solutions can significantly reduce processing times compared to traditional systems.

This makes Ripple’s infrastructure appealing to institutions seeking faster international transfers.

Why Adoption Matters for XRP

Adoption alone does not automatically drive prices. However, expanding real-world usage strengthens the underlying value proposition of a blockchain ecosystem. When Ripple adoption grows in Asia and the Middle East, it can:

  • Increase network activity
  • Expand institutional exposure
  • Improve liquidity flows
  • Strengthen long-term ecosystem credibility

If blockchain-based settlement systems become more widely used, the role of XRP as a liquidity bridge could expand as well.The question of whether XRP is undervalued depends on perspective. From a purely speculative standpoint, price may fluctuate based on broader market sentiment. From a fundamental perspective, investors often evaluate:

  • Network utility
  • Institutional partnerships
  • Global expansion
  • Transaction growth
  • Market positioning

Compared to some newer altcoins with limited real-world integration, XRP benefits from:

  • Established infrastructure
  • Deep exchange liquidity
  • A long operational history
  • Enterprise-facing technology

If adoption continues to grow steadily, some analysts argue XRP may not fully reflect its ecosystem expansion.

Risks to Consider

Balanced analysis is important. Potential risks include:

  • Global market downturns
  • Slower-than-expected institutional adoption
  • Regulatory uncertainties
  • Competition from other blockchain payment networks

While Ripple’s expansion is notable, crypto markets remain highly volatile.
